Transaction f28bd340aa98eeccd8140e3e6741cd889c3d6903f720d709765f5069f153574a

3 Input
2 Outputs
  • f28bd340aa98eeccd8140e3e6741cd889c3d6903f720d709765f5069f153574a:0
  • value  1679528
    address  39emm7WHNj5wXANKrftj1snE5ZB2RA4bEw
  • f28bd340aa98eeccd8140e3e6741cd889c3d6903f720d709765f5069f153574a:1
  • value  25748642
    address  17qnbyLvNRGaYtv6BqXwybUATXGgfAwP5f